Why students switch to Learnco
What students love about NotebookLM, and how Learnco approaches it differently.
Flashcards and quizzes, not just chat
NotebookLM lets you chat with your sources. Learnco goes further: it generates flashcard decks with SM-2 spaced repetition and practice quizzes with multiple choice, true/false, and short answer questions — the active recall tools that actually drive retention.
SM-2 spaced repetition built in
Every flashcard deck uses the SM-2 algorithm to schedule reviews at the optimal interval. NotebookLM has no built-in review system — it's a research tool, not a study tool.
AI podcasts from your notes
Both tools generate audio, but Learnco's podcasts are built specifically for study review — listen on your commute and retain more from your notes.
YouTube and lecture audio ingestion
Paste a YouTube link or upload an MP3/MP4 lecture recording. Learnco transcribes it and generates notes, flashcards, and quizzes. NotebookLM supports Google Drive and web links but has limited audio/video ingestion.
Built for students, not researchers
NotebookLM is a general-purpose AI notebook. Learnco is purpose-built for studying: every feature — from note structure to quiz generation to spaced repetition — is designed around the active recall loop that drives exam performance.
Learnco vs NotebookLM
A quick head-to-head on the features students actually use.
| Feature | Learnco | NotebookLM |
|---|---|---|
| Chat with your documents | Yes — AI chat on every note | Core feature |
| AI-generated flashcards | Yes, with SM-2 spaced repetition | Not a core feature |
| Practice quizzes (MC, T/F, short answer) | Yes, with explanations | Limited quiz features |
| Spaced repetition scheduling | SM-2 built in | Not offered |
| AI audio podcast | Study-focused audio from notes | Audio Overview feature |
| YouTube video ingestion | Paste link, get notes + flashcards | YouTube link as source |
| Lecture audio/video upload | MP3, WAV, MP4 supported | Limited audio support |
| Homework helper | Step-by-step problem solving | Not offered |
| Essay grader | Built in with structured feedback | Not offered |
| Free tier | Yes, no credit card | Free (usage limits) |
